Usage

One of many templates available to sign for an anon that didn't give their signature.

Similar to {{Unsigned IP}}, a signing template that produces the IP followed by (talk) and date, this template also gives links to the user's contributions and a WHOIS lookup.

Parameters

  1. The IP: the four- or six-digit numerical computer address (this can be found by going to the page's history and clicking Revision history search for WikiBlame)
  2. Time and date: the datestamp from the edit history, should be labeled as UTC

Examples

Typing {{subst:Uns-ip|127.0.0.1|23:23, 1 May 2007 (UTC)}}

will yield: — Preceding unsigned comment added by 127.0.0.1 (talkcontribsWHOIS) 23:23, 1 May 2007 (UTC)
